Beschrijving
In a gripping narrative that intertwines suspense and clever twists, the story unfolds with an intricate plot that draws readers into the shadowy world of crime and technology. A once-quiet setting becomes a cauldron of tension as a series of unpredictable events unfolds, sending characters on a collision course with danger. With a tight-knit group of skilled detectives and programmers, the lines blur between reality and the eerie simulations they create.
As the characters navigate a landscape riddled with peril, their unique skill sets and personal conflicts come to the forefront. Each character’s motivation reveals deeper themes of loyalty, trust, and the lengths one will go to protect those they love. The stakes escalate with every page, as they confront malevolent forces that threaten not only their lives but also the very fabric of their existence.
Complex and richly drawn, the novel offers more than just a thrilling mystery; it probes into the human psyche and the ethical dilemmas posed by technology. Readers will find themselves enthralled by the puzzle laid before them, eager to explore the consequences of the choices made in a world where every decision could lead to life or death.
